2025-09-01
Politician(s) lobbied: Emer Higgins (TD), Dáil Éireann, the Oireachtas; Shane Moynihan (TD), Dáil Éireann, the Oireachtas; Paul Nicholas Gogarty (TD), Dáil Éireann, the Oireachtas; Eoin Ó Broin (TD), Dáil Éireann, the Oireachtas; Shirley O'Hara (Councillor), South Dublin County Council
Intent: We were not in favour of the purchase. We requested clarification from Minister O’Callaghan on the scale of the purchase; clarification about expected continued functioning of amenities on Citywest Hotel lands e.g. the leisure centre and a restaurant.We requested a Local Community Consultation group to support communication between the community and the state. We also requested commencement of the Local Area Plan process, as committed to County Development Plan.
Methods: Social Media
Details & Methods:
MethodDescription
We met with our TDs to communicate resident concerns in relation to the government's potential purchase of Citywest Hotel
2023-03-05
Politician(s) lobbied: Eoin O'Broin (Councillor), South Dublin County Council; William Joseph Carey (Councillor), South Dublin County Council; Shirley O'Hara (Councillor), South Dublin County Council
Intent: To learn about proposed plans for a Primary Care Centre which would require rezoning of land. To better understand the what would be needed to secure rezoning and implications of any change to the zoning of that specific site, on the zoning of surrounding sites.
Methods: Email, Meeting
Details & Methods:
MethodDescription
Saggart Village Residents Association was contacted by Feasible
a company which was considering building a Primary Care Centre for the HSE
on lands in Saggart currently not zoned for that purpose. The potential developer wished to show Saggart Village Residents Association the plans for the Centre. SVRA requested information in order to learn about the rezoing process.
